How Far From Yoder to ...

We spend a lot of time looking through Gazetteers that were published in the late 1800's and early 1900's. Many of the Gazetteers include the distance from a community such as Yoder to various places of note, such as the White House.

With a nod to our favorite Gazetteers, the straight-line distance beginning in Yoder and extending to:

  • Hutchinson, which is the Seat of Reno County, lies 9 miles [14.5 km]<1> to the north northwest. If you could walk a straight line from Yoder to Hutchinson, with an average speed<6> of 2.2 miles [3.5 km] per hour, it would take four to five hours to make the trip. A horse and buggy averaging 3.2 miles [5.1 km] per hour would take a little over three hours.
  • Topeka, which is the State Capital of Kansas, lies 140 miles [225.3 km] to the east northeast (ENE). Driving, with an average speed of 63 miles [101.4 km] per hour, would take less than three hours, a buggy would take 6 days and walking would take 8 days.
  • The White House (Washington, DC) is 1,126 miles [1,812.1 km] to the east (E). Driving would take over two days, a buggy would take 44 days and walking would take 64 days.

<7>The shortest line can be visualized by stretching a string on a Globe from Point A to Point B - this is known as a Great Circle Route. Where you might expect the shortest route from Yoder to the Middle East to be East and South, the Great Circle Route actually lies to the North and East.
